Background
The weaving idea is a general term taken from spinning and weaving, but with the continuous development and perfection of a weaving knowledge system and a subject system, particularly after the technologies of non-woven textile material, three-dimensional compound knitting and the like are produced, the present textile not only is the traditional hand-made spinning and weaving, but also comprises the textile for clothing, industry and decoration produced by the non-woven fabric technology, the modern three-dimensional knitting technology, the modern electrostatic nano-net forming technology and the like, therefore, modern textile refers to a multi-scale structure processing technology of fiber or fiber aggregate, the ancient textile and printing and dyeing technology of China has a very long history, and as early as the original society, ancient people know to use local materials to adapt to the change of climate, use natural resources as raw materials for textile and printing and dyeing, and to make simple hand-made textile tools, apparel, airbags and curtain carpets in daily life are products of textile and printing technologies.
The prior art has the following problems:
1. the existing fiber softening method is generally a chemical finishing method or a mechanical finishing method, the chemical finishing method is to use a softening agent for treatment, and adjust the frictional resistance between the fabric, the fiber tissue or between the fiber and the human body so as to achieve the softening effect, the mechanical finishing method is to use various softening machines for physical treatment such as beating and rubbing the fabric, and the like, so that the relative positions between the fiber and between the yarn and the yarn are changed, thereby improving the bending rigidity of the fabric, and reducing the frictional resistance so as to achieve the purpose of soft hand feeling, and the existing chemical finishing method and the existing mechanical finishing method do not play a good role in softening the fabric fibers, so the practicability of the fabric is greatly reduced.

The reference signs are: 1. a fixed base; 2. an operation table; 3. a working bin; 4. a first protection bin; 5. a drive motor; 6. a shaking rod; 7. a second protection bin; 8. a drive assembly; 81. a power supply bin; 82. a driving bin; 83. a protection bin; 84. a telescopic rod; 85. a pushing block; 851. sleeving a hole; 9. a plate is patted; 91. and (5) rubbing the lines.

Referring to fig. 1-3, a softening device for softening textile fabric fibers comprises a fixed base 1, an operation table 2 is fixedly mounted at the top end of the fixed base 1, a working bin 3 fixedly mounted at the top end of the fixed base 1 is arranged at the top of the operation table 2, a first protection bin 4 is fixedly mounted at the top end of the working bin 3, a driving motor 5 is fixedly mounted in an inner cavity of the first protection bin 4, a shaking rod 6 is fixedly mounted at the bottom end of the driving motor 5, a second protection bin 7 fixedly mounted at the top end of the working bin 3 is arranged on one side of the shaking rod 6, a driving assembly 8 is fixedly mounted in an inner cavity of the second protection bin 7, and a beating plate 9 is fixedly mounted at the bottom end of the driving assembly 8.
